Humidity and CO2 probes in the Hollow Pines trial drift roughly 0.4% per week, so the Verdanta controller recalibrates against the reference probe on a rolling window. More frequent recalibration burns I2C bandwidth and delays actuator loops; less frequent lets drift exceed the alarm band. Reviewer: confirm the window math handles probe dropout without resetting accumulated offsets, and that memory for drift history stays under the per-zone budget. Current tuning constants are below.

constants for tageg-kagag:
QUOTAS = {
    "kelax": 495,
    "istath": 366,
    "tammir": 108,
    "novdor": 730,
    "casax": 816,
    "quenael": 874,
    "pelius": 403,
}

Subject: Pool Car Key Cabinet — New Location

The key cabinet for the pool cars has moved from reception to the alcove beside the Marwick Room on the ground floor. Sign keys out on the clipboard, return them by 17:30, and note any fuel below a quarter tank. The cabinet is now keypad-locked; assistants booking cars should use the access code below.

turnstile pass: bdg-EVG-1

Plugin authors extending the Lumenfind ranking pipeline should note that the default BM25 saturation parameter changed from 1.2 to 0.9 in this cycle. Our evaluation set (built from anonymized Harbrook Library queries) showed title-field boosts now dominate unless your plugin re-normalizes scores after the rescore phase. If your custom scorer registers before `synonym_expand`, verify output ranges stay within [0, 10]. We reproduced the drift consistently on the staging cluster and captured the token below for cross-referencing.

pipeline stamp: htk3_cc5